The Anatomy of "Big Video" What exactly qualifies as "big video"? It is not just about file size; it is about impact. Big video content in the lifestyle and entertainment niche has three distinct pillars: 1. Cinematic Quality in Vlogging Lifestyle influencers have become directors. They use gimbals, drones, and color grading. A video about "Organizing my pantry" now features rack-focus shots and ambient lighting. This quality leap makes mundane chores look like a Netflix special, keeping viewers hooked for the entire duration. 2. Vertical Dominance (The Mobile IMAX) Platforms like YouTube Shorts, Instagram Reels, and TikTok have perfected the vertical big video. For entertainment, this means immersive, full-screen action. For lifestyle, it means detailed close-ups of cooking, fashion hauls, and travel vistas without black bars. The "top" content creators understand that vertical does not mean cheap; it means intimate. 3. Long-Form Deep Dives Paradoxically, as we get shorter content, the demand for long-form "big video" is surging. Viewers want to escape into 45-minute vlogs of someone building a log cabin in the woods or a 2-hour documentary about a celebrity’s tour prep. This is the "entertainment" sector fighting back against algorithmic fatigue.
